Right next to the JR Hiroshima station, Hotel Granvia Hiroshima was the perfect location if you want to minimize time moving from one lodging to another. It's a short walk from the shinkansen platform to the hotel lobby. I incorrectly booked a smoking room and it was a very unpleasant room, if you didn't smoke. To get a non-smokibg room, there was an upcharge of about USD$50 per night, considering how nice the hotel ended up, it was a bargain. The non-smoking rooms were very pleasant and located in the higher floors. We had our luggage shipped to Osaka, avoiding lugging around big suitcases on the train. The bell captain took care of all the arrangements and paperwork, even calling ahead to our next hotel, to be sure. That is excellent service (and happily, the luggage all ended up i in our room (!) at the promised time). Finally, the hotel offers a discount to eat at their restaurants for guests of the hotel. The buffet breakfast was totally worth it for about USD$20 with the discount.
